Compliance Inspector (CI) Heather Radney conducted an investigation of the allegation that Michaela grabbed Child A by the shoulders and shook her. She also set her down and hit her back. There was no excessive force and no bruises to child. Child A had no symptoms and no complaints or pain. The allegation is substantiated based on the following information:
5 CSR 25-500.182(1)(C)7. - Physical punishment including, but not limited to, spanking, slapping, shaking, biting, or pulling hair shall be prohibited.
5 CSR 25-500.182(1)(C)3. - Only constructive, age-appropriate methods of discipline shall be used to help children develop self-control and assume responsibility for their own actions.
On February 7, 2024, CI Radney conducted interviews with Dawn Ashlock, Brenda Taylor and Child A. Dawn Ashlock stated Brenda was in the classroom when the incident occurred. Brenda told her about the incident the next morning. Brenda told her she was getting on to Child A about running in the classroom and Michaela intervened and grabbed and shook Child A and sat her down. When Michaela sat Child A down, she sat her down hard and Child A's back hit the cabinet. This was for discipline. She immediately texted Tawnya Pace and told her what Brenda had told her. Brenda Taylor reported she had gotten on to Child A for running around the room. Child A started running and Michaela grabbed her on her upper arms, picked her up, put her on the green carpet, and started shaking her using her two arms on Child A's upper arms causing her head to go back and forth. Michaela was yelling "no running" at her and that she was tired of messing with her. Michaela pushed her with one arm/hand to Child A's chest and Child A fell backwards and she hit the bookshelf with her back and her bottom hitting the floor and she started crying. She thinks Michaela was disciplining or punishing Child A. Michaela did not help Child A up. She told Dawn the next morning about the incident. Child A reported Michaela got on to her about something very mean. She cried and felt sad.
5 CSR 25-500.192(5)(A) - In case of accident or injury to a child, the provider shall notify the parent(s) immediately. If the child requires emergency medical care, the provider shall follow the parent's(s') written instructions.
On February 7, 2024, CI Radney conducted interviews with Brenda Taylor and Dawn Ashlock. Brenda reported she saw the incident occur and did not tell anyone until she told Dawn the next morning. Dawn reported she learned of the incident the morning after it occurred and she texted Tawnya about the incident.
On February 7, 2024, CI Radney reviewed documentation of the incident from Child A's folder.
On March 1, 2024, CI Radney conducted an interview with Tawnya Pace. She reported the incident occurred January 25, 2024. She learned about it on Friday, January 26, 2024 when Dawn texted her. She and Jesse called Parent A together on Friday, January 26, 2024.
On March 6, 2024, CI Radney conducted an interview with Parent A. She reported the incident occurred on Thursday, January 25, 2024 and she was told about it on Friday, January 26, 2024.
On March 6, 2024, CI Radney conducted an interview with Jesse Cox. She reported the incident occurred on Thursday, January 25, 2024 and she learned of the incident on Friday, January 26, 2024. She was on the phone call with Parent A on Friday, January 26, 2024.
